Q:What is the cheapest way to send a piece of furniture?
The cheapest way to ship furniture often involves Less-Than-Truckload (LTL) freight for larger items or sharing space, using bus freight for distance savings if it fits rules, or trying ride-share apps (Dolly, GoShare) for local moves ; for very tight budgets, DIY with a rental truck/U-Haul, or even selling & repurchasing might beat shipping costs. Proper packaging with cardboard, moving blankets, and corner protectors is crucial to avoid damage, which drastically increases costs.
